<h2 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-the-most-common-hulu-network-error-codes-can-be-fixed-easily">The Most Common Hulu Network Error Codes Can be Fixed Easily</h2>



<ol class="wp-block-list">
<li><strong>Restart your Roku.</strong>&nbsp;If you are using Hulu with Roku then being logged in can cause you trouble. You have to apply the same thing with another streaming device.</li>



<li><strong>Restart your network devices.&nbsp;</strong>You must restart your home-based network router or modem. Hulu requires at least 6 Mbps speed. If you want to enjoy LIVE TV then 8 Mbps speed is required for Hulu with Live TV.</li>



<li><strong>Unplug your streaming device</strong>. The wired connection may be stretched which needs to be checked. Therefore, we recommend unplugging the home network devices, you can leave them unplugged for a minute. And replug them after a minute or 2 and it will work fine.</li>



<li>Switch from a wireless connection to a wired network connection. This is required to check the speeding-up connection. You can use a wired connection instead of WiFi.</li>



<li>Update your Hulu app, or try reinstalling it. If your app is not updated or you are using an older version that is not supported by your device, you will get a Hulu network error. But that will be solved after your update your app.</li>
</ol>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Hulu Network Error Codes and How to Fix?</h2>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-hulu-error-rununck13">Hulu Error rununck13</h3>



<blockquote class="wp-block-quote is-layout-flow wp-block-quote-is-layout-flow">
<p>This can cause Buffering and Playback Issues that can irritate you while streaming. </p>
</blockquote>



<p>If you are trying to troubleshoot the problems. You must try these steps to fix the error that still showing pops up. You must try these common steps.</p>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li>Clear your browser’s cache. Clearing the cache of your browser can make your experience smoother and faster.</li>



<li>Delete and reinstall the Hulu app.</li>
</ul>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-hulu-error-p-dev-320">Hulu Error p-dev 320</h3>



<blockquote class="wp-block-quote is-layout-flow wp-block-quote-is-layout-flow">
<p>The Hulu Error with displayed &#8220;p-dev 320&#8221; can be caused due a to Digital Media Player.</p>
</blockquote>



<p>If you are getting Hulu Error p-dev 320 that means there is a communication problem. The Problem can be between Hulu servers or Apps or Hulu web player. The cause can be an outdated version of the app on your device, issues with Hulu, or the not able to connect with your network.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-hulu-error-5003">Hulu Error 5003</h3>



<blockquote class="wp-block-quote is-layout-flow wp-block-quote-is-layout-flow">
<p>Hulu Error 5003 can make Playback Issue to your Hulu device.</p>
</blockquote>



<p>Hulu Error 5003 is a Playback error that can be usually related to the streaming device. This error can pop up on the Apple TV, smartphone, PS4, Macbook, etc. Try the Belwo steps to over solve the problem.</p>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li>Restart your device.</li>



<li>Delete and reinstall the Hulu app.</li>



<li>Restart your router.</li>
</ul>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-error-3-and-5">Error 3 and 5</h3>



<blockquote class="wp-block-quote is-layout-flow wp-block-quote-is-layout-flow">
<p>Error 3 &amp; 5 can happens because of an Internet connection issue. Therefore you must <a href="https://www.trickyenough.com/program-universal-remote-control/"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ener">check your connection</a> first.</p>
</blockquote>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li>Check your Internet connection.</li>



<li>Restart your device.</li>



<li>unplug your modem and router for one minute.</li>



<li>reinstall the Hulu app.</li>



<li>update your device.</li>
</ul>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-error-16">Error 16</h3>



<blockquote class="wp-block-quote is-layout-flow wp-block-quote-is-layout-flow">
<p>Error 16 is for the Invalid region issue. </p>
</blockquote>



<p>In some countries, while using Hulu you may get error 16. That is because it may not be supported in your country. You can try using a VPN to solve this issue.</p>



<p>If you are in the US and still have Error 16. This means you have to Turn off your VPN or proxy if in the US.</p>



<p><strong>Solution:</strong></p>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li>Must be in the US.</li>



<li>Turn off VPN or proxy if in the US.</li>
</ul>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-error-0326-2203-3307-3321-3322-3336-3343">Error 0326, 2203, 3307, 3321, 3322, 3336, 3343</h3>



<blockquote class="wp-block-quote is-layout-flow wp-block-quote-is-layout-flow">
<p>Error 0326, 2203, 3307, 3321, 3322, 3336, 3343 are all related to the conten protection. The content you are trying to view may be protected as per your age or your region.</p>
</blockquote>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li>There is not much that can be done. But still, you can try the below things.</li>



<li>Connect to an HDMI cable if using another type of cable.</li>



<li>update the browser or switch to another browser.</li>



<li>refresh the page.</li>
</ul>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-400-error">400 Error</h3>



<blockquote class="wp-block-quote is-layout-flow wp-block-quote-is-layout-flow">
<p>Error 400 indicates the issues with your Account. You can fix it by applying these simple steps.</p>
</blockquote>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li><a href="https://www.trickyenough.com/internet-speed-on-your-taskbar/"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ener">Check the internet connection</a>.</li>



<li>Reinstall the Hulu app.</li>



<li>Remove the device from the account.</li>



<li>Add it back in (You must keep in mind that this can be done only on its <a href="https://www.hulu.com/welcome"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ener">official website called hulu.com</a> → account → manage devices).</li>



<li>Contact Hulu support.</li>



<li>Check if your subscription is working properly.</li>
</ul>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-error-500">Error 500</h3>



<blockquote class="wp-block-quote is-layout-flow wp-block-quote-is-layout-flow">
<p>500 error is well known for the server issue/error and if you exprienceing same with hulu, don&#8217;t worry it&#8217;s same. The error is from the serveres of the hulu.</p>
</blockquote>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li>Check the internet connection.</li>



<li>Switch browsers.</li>



<li>Wait for a few minutes or for more time to let servers start to work.</li>
</ul>



<p><strong>Suggested:</strong></p>



<p><a href="https://www.trickyenough.com/fix-500-internal-server-error/"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ener">How to fix 500 Internal Server Errors by Yourself</a>?</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-error-bya-403-007">Error BYA-403-007</h3>



<blockquote class="wp-block-quote is-layout-flow wp-block-quote-is-layout-flow">
<p>Error BYA-403-007 is for the Playback of Hulu service shutdown issue.</p>
</blockquote>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li>It will always be counted as an unfair interruption on Hulu if other videos work on it.</li>



<li><strong>Please note</strong>: Check your internet connection always when you see this error. Please remember, always keep your phone updated.</li>



<li>Last, wait for Hulu to fix the problem while you are trying to fix it.</li>
</ul>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-error-hdcp">Error HDCP</h3>



<blockquote class="wp-block-quote is-layout-flow wp-block-quote-is-layout-flow">
<p>Error HDCP is indicating that its an Anti-piracy issue.</p>
</blockquote>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li>Unplug the HDMI cable and TV or streaming device then plug it back in.</li>



<li>Try a different HDMI.</li>



<li>Try different TV or monitor.</li>
</ul>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Things to do Google Home Won&#8217;t Connect to Wi-Fi</h2>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">Cross-check if Google Home is connected properly</h3>



<p>Here is how you will do it:</p>



<ol class="wp-block-list"><li>Open the Google Home App and tap on the device you wish to configure.</li><li>Open the settings or Gear button on the app that asks for an updated wi-fi password.</li></ol>



<figure class="wp-block-image"><a href="https://www.trickyenough.com/wp-content/uploads/2021/02/1-1adc7ed1.jpg"><img decoding="async" src="https://www.trickyenough.com/wp-content/uploads/2021/02/1-1adc7ed1-1024x576.jpg" alt="Things to do Google Home Won't Connect to Wi-Fi"/></a></figure>



<ol class="wp-block-list"><li>Pick a wifi connection and then from the options choose to tap on forgetting the network.</li><li>Select on add option which is visible on the home screen of the application.</li><li>Tap on Set up device and later choose New devices.</li><li>Select Home to add Google home which is to followed by tapping on Next option.</li><li>Go ahead with the other instructions that pop on the screen for further help.</li></ol>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">Change the Google Home or Routers position</h3>



<p>The router is the one and only way (bridge) with which Google Home can get access to an internet connection. Hence now you know the connection terminal you should be looking at first. That&#8217;s going to be easy, just change the place of your Google home device which is closer to the router. Now see if there is any positive outcome for it.</p>



<p>And if the Google home device now works better after you placed it near to the router it is clear that there is some problem with either the router or there is any kind of hindrance among the device or the router.</p>



<p>A one-time solution is to place the Google Home device closer to the router or change the position of the router to a convenient position where it covers a larger area. Possibly try keeping it away from walls or other devices.</p>



<p>Just in case moving the router is not possible, or keeping the Google Home device closer to the router or rebooting does not help then you should consider changing your router with a new one. A new one would have a much better antenna hence giving better connectivity to all the devices connected to it.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">Turn of all of the other devices that are connected to your Network</h3>



<p>This may obviously sound a bit of extreme measure or even a real method to just get that one device functioning well. However, the bandwidth the Google Home device or any wireless devices receiving to keep running can be a real pain. And that is under the situation when there are a number of devices connected to the internet via the same network. Hence if there are a number of devices connected to the network you will experience connectivity problems. Such as lagged surfing or buffering while you play a video on YouTube or Netflix, songs freezing, or maybe not even playing.</p>



<p>When it comes to Google Home devices it usually responds with a tad delay and late responses. In technical terms this isn&#8217;t an issue with the kind of services or products you are trying to use through a router, it is just that more bandwidth/high-speed connectivity is required. This usually happens when all of the bandwidth is exhausted by the existing connected devices. The best probable solution is either disconnect the devices that you aren&#8217;t using at all. Or you can upgrade your bandwidth.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">Rebooting Google Home and Router</h3>



<p>And if the disconnecting all the devices that usually according to use use the maximum bandwidth does not help at all. Then you should probably try rebooting the main Google Home device, and while you do it just make sure you restart your router as well just to be double sure you rebooted everything.</p>



<p>Rebooting Google home and router by plugging off the device from its power cord, after you have done that wait for at least a minute. Now try reconnecting.</p>



<figure class="wp-block-image"><a href="https://www.trickyenough.com/wp-content/uploads/2021/02/2-064cbc93.jpg"><img decoding="async" src="https://www.trickyenough.com/wp-content/uploads/2021/02/2-064cbc93-1024x576.jpg" alt="Rebooting Google home "/></a></figure>



<p>Just another way to do it:</p>



<ol class="wp-block-list"><li>Select the device you wish to reboot on the app.</li><li>Tap on the setting icon located at the top screen which can be identified by 3 dots in horizontal position.</li><li>Now tap on the reboot option.</li></ol>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">Still no luck?</h3>



<p>As far as now till here you must have a rough idea of how Google Home uses an internet connection, placed it near to the router at a point where the connection established is strong enough. Get rid of any hindrance from all other devices, as both devices rebooted and reset for not just Google Home Device but for your router as well.</p>



<p>Now rather than contacting Google Home Device support there isn&#8217;t much you can do. There is probably a bug that could be rectified with a simple update but more than that there is a problem with the Google Home Device.</p>



<p>And if it isn&#8217;t the case then your router is to be blamed as if it would have been working fine then it&#8217;s a network issue. And if not there are good chances that the device is facing some kind of problem whether software or either hardware.</p>



<p>Google usually offers a replacement for such new faulty devices, but first, you need to contact them and share the problem which you have been facing entirely.</p>

<h3 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-do-your-homework">Do Your Homework</h3>



<p>Before you approach an influencer, the
first thing you need to do is research about them.</p>



<p>This will help you <a href="https://www.trickyenough.com/skyscraper-technique-to-get-more-traffic/"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ener" aria-label="build a better outreach message (opens in a new tab)">build a better outreach message</a> that can really connect to them. Plus, you’ll be able to communicate with them, how this partnership will be useful to their audience.</p>



<p>Be in sync with their latest updates.
Stay updated with whatever new techniques, ideas, products they talk about. Go
through their work as much as you can and note the content that you could best
connect/relate to.</p>



<p>This will give you the right stuff to
talk about in your partnership pitch.</p>



<p>One fine example of using this intel is the following outreach template.</p>



<figure class="wp-block-image"><img fetchpriority="high" decoding="async" width="800" height="743" src="https://www.trickyenough.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/06/Desktop.jpg" alt="" class="wp-image-10464" srcset="https://www.trickyenough.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/06/Desktop.jpg 800w, https://www.trickyenough.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/06/Desktop-300x279.jpg 300w, https://www.trickyenough.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/06/Desktop-768x713.jpg 768w" sizes="(max-width: 800px) 100vw, 800px" /></figure>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-personalisation">Personalisation</h3>



<p>Almost, <a rel="noreferrer noopener" aria-label=" (opens in a new tab)" href="https://neilpatel.com/blog/6-email-personalization-techniques/" target="_blank">95 percent</a> of the companies say that personalization of outreach emails is crucial for their Present and future success.</p>



<p>But are they doing it right?</p>



<p>And also 60 percent of the marketers agree that they struggle at making the perfect email copies for their clients. Clearly, there is a need for understanding it better.</p>



<p>Here’s what you need to know about personalizing your outreach emails.</p>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li><strong>Address with the name:</strong> This one can simply be explained with the case that Daniel Scocco of Daily Blog Tips mentions in one of his articles. </li>
</ul>



<figure class="wp-block-image"><img decoding="async" width="558" height="369" src="https://www.trickyenough.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/06/Dozens.jpg" alt="" class="wp-image-10472" srcset="https://www.trickyenough.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/06/Dozens.jpg 558w, https://www.trickyenough.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/06/Dozens-300x198.jpg 300w" sizes="(max-width: 558px) 100vw, 558px" /></figure>



<p><strong><em> </em></strong>Do you get the point?<br> <br>It’s simple. Addressing people by their name makes them feel that you are actually talking to them.<br> Plus, it would let them know that you actually made an effort to know their name (in case you are reaching out to an influential website, and not an influential person).</p>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li><strong>Be relevant:</strong> Before we talk about this, you need to know that approaching influencers away from your business’ niche will make no sense at all. For the worse, it’ll be a waste of your efforts and the influencer’s time.</li>
</ul>



<p>So, be as relevant as you can be. Don’t drop the ball by being too lazy to be relevant.<br><br>For example, in the outreach template mentioned in the previous section, the sentence <em>“Your recent post [blog post] really resonated with me.” </em>indicates relevance. The influencer’s own post would always be relevant for this conversation, right?<br><br>Well, that’s just one way to start. The best way to find more is to research about the influencer and dig into details that matter.<br><br>It’s important to note that you don’t particularly need to talk about their blog/post for relevance. You can also use elements in their content that you relate to. For example, a useful tip that you could really connect to or something that they usually talk about on Twitter.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-ego-stroke">Ego-stroke</h3>



<p>While coming off as someone who’s easily
impressed isn’t recommendable, giving the influencer mild ego-strokes can get
you to the promised land.</p>



<p>Have a look at this outreach copy for
reference.</p>



<p><em>Hi,</em></p>



<p><em>I’m <strong>[YOUR NAME]</strong>
of <strong>[YOUR BUSINESS]</strong>. Today morning,
while researching about <strong>[A RELEVANT
TOPIC]</strong>, I came across your post <strong>[A
RELATED POST BY THE INFLUENCER]</strong>. Totally impressed by your ideas and
approach. Also enjoyed reading your take on the <strong>[ANOTHER TOPIC/SUBTOPIC FROM THE INFLUENCER’s CHANNEL]</strong>.</em></p>



<p><em><br>
And, then going through your blog, I realized my brand <strong>[BRAND NAME]</strong>’s products can be useful for your audience.</em></p>



<p><em>Here’s a video <strong>[LINK
TO VIDEO OR POST IF VIDEO ISN’t AVAILABLE] </strong>for your understanding.</em></p>



<p><em>Hope to hear from you soon!</em></p>



<p>Apart from being simple, sweet, and short, this outreach copy praises the blogger. While it didn’t beat around the bush at all, it made sure the blogger knows that the sender really likes and appreciates their work.</p>



<p>A pinch of flattery always works. But make sure you don’t go overboard with the praises. That can make you sound too sales already.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-important-things-to-keep-in-mind-while-writing">Important Things to Keep in Mind While Writing</h3>



<p>Apart from researching the influencer, being relevant to them, personalizing your emails, and using ego-strokes, here’s a number of important things to keep in mind while writing the mail.</p>



<ol class="wp-block-list">
<li>Use subject lines that are somewhat vague to peak interest, but still address the person by name, so, it still stays personal.</li>



<li>Pay your greetings to show you are friendly. Keep &#8217;em short and sweet.      </li>



<li>Establish your identity at the starting of the mail. For example,<br>      <br>      <em>Hi,<br>      <br>      I am [YOUR NAME], [DESIGNATION] of [YOUR BUSINESS] &#8230;..</em><br>      </li>



<li>Don’t copy and send a generic template email to everyone. These influencers are experts and would clearly know when you’ll be saving yourself efforts.      </li>



<li>Don’t talk too much about your company’s philosophy, history or anything that’s not really required. Get to the point and click shoot!</li>



<li>Make sure you offer them what they want. This can only be achieved if you have done your homework (i.e., the first section of this post). If you succeed in pulling this off, chances are any marketer or influencer you outreach will understand the value of being associated with a brand that believes in in-depth research.</li>
</ol>

<h3 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-after-you-ve-mailed-be-ready-for-rejection-and-improvisation">After You’ve Mailed, Be Ready for Rejection and Improvisation</h3>



<p>Even after writing the best email of your
life, you may still not receive a positive response. Reason?</p>



<p>The influencers you are targeting are popular. They receive hundreds of emails from marketers, business owners, and fans trying to get them to do one thing or the other. While one reason for not getting a response from them can be a weak pitch, another one can be your email being lost in their inbox.</p>



<p>The best thing you can do here is not get
disheartened and go on with a follow-up.</p>



<p>Write them another email or social media post/message to reach back to them. Nadya Khoja of Venngage used Twitter.</p>



<figure class="wp-block-image"><img decoding="async" width="975" height="846" src="https://www.trickyenough.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/06/tweet.jpg" alt="" class="wp-image-10467" srcset="https://www.trickyenough.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/06/tweet.jpg 975w, https://www.trickyenough.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/06/tweet-300x260.jpg 300w, https://www.trickyenough.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/06/tweet-768x666.jpg 768w" sizes="(max-width: 975px) 100vw, 975px" /><figcaption class="wp-element-caption">Image Credits: Screenshot taken from the <a href="https://twitter.com/NadyaKhoja"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ener nofollow">website</a></figcaption></figure>



<p>Sweet, right? The same can work for you as well. Twitter is indeed a great way of reminding someone that you are waiting for a response. Plus, this gets more words going around for the influencer.<br> <br>For example, if you tag an influencer in a tweet like this, their audience would know that they are up to something new. This will create a kind of buzz and can work in both of your favors.</p>



<p>But, then, does it always pay well?</p>



<p>Well, not in all cases. Like this one
when Nadya tried reaching Neil Patel. Twice through email, once through Twitter
and none of it worked. But, right as it should be, she didn’t give up.</p>



<p>She took the unconventional route this
time.</p>



<p>She sent him a message using his contact form on Quicksprout.</p>



<figure class="wp-block-image"><img decoding="async" width="975" height="825" src="https://www.trickyenough.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/06/Just-Email-me.jpg" alt="Writing A Flawless Influencer Partnership" class="wp-image-10468" srcset="https://www.trickyenough.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/06/Just-Email-me.jpg 975w, https://www.trickyenough.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/06/Just-Email-me-300x254.jpg 300w, https://www.trickyenough.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/06/Just-Email-me-768x650.jpg 768w" sizes="(max-width: 975px) 100vw, 975px" /><figcaption class="wp-element-caption">Image Credits: Screenshot taken from the website</figcaption></figure>



<p>And at last, she received a reply.</p>



<figure class="wp-block-image"><img decoding="async" width="800" height="600" src="https://www.trickyenough.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/06/Neil-patel.jpg" alt="Writing A Flawless Influencer Partnership" class="wp-image-10469" srcset="https://www.trickyenough.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/06/Neil-patel.jpg 800w, https://www.trickyenough.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/06/Neil-patel-300x225.jpg 300w, https://www.trickyenough.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/06/Neil-patel-768x576.jpg 768w" sizes="(max-width: 800px) 100vw, 800px" /><figcaption class="wp-element-caption">Image Credits: Screenshot taken from the website</figcaption></figure>



<p>The way Nadya accepted rejections and
approached them is commendable and gives us all much to learn.</p>



<p><strong>Bottom line: </strong>Don’t give up after rejection. Persistence is the key to winning over them.</p>



<p>Speaking of when to stop seeking a response, it’s important to know that almost <a href="https://www.marketingdonut.co.uk/sales/sales-techniques-and-negotiations/why-you-must-follow-up-leads"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ener nofollow" aria-label=" (opens in a new tab)">80%</a> of prospects say ‘no’ four times before ultimately saying ‘yes’. And 92% of people give up after getting a ‘no’ four times.</p>



<p>Turns out, only 8% make the cut to get a
‘yes’.</p>



<p>This gives a rough idea about how many times you can try reaching out to an influencer.</p>



<p>Apart from this, remember that sending too many follow-up emails can be a plain turn-off. Studies show that open rates after 9 emails fall down to only <a aria-label=" (opens in a new tab)" href="https://blog.mailshake.com/100-sales-statistics/"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ener nofollow">7%</a> at the most.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ading" id="h-still-not-working-make-sure-you-re-not-landing-in-the-spam-box">Still not Working? Make Sure You’re not Landing in the Spam Box</h3>



<p>One of the worst things about outreach is
ending up in the spam box. And whether you know it or not, this happens more
often than you’d expect.</p>



<p>But, then, it’s nothing unnatural. Even the big players fall prey to the spam filter. The question is, how to rise above it?</p>



<p><strong>Suggested</strong>:</p>



<p><a href="https://www.trickyenough.com/how-to-get-rid-of-spam/"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ener" aria-label="How to get rid of Spam Emails? (opens in a new tab)">How to get rid of Spam Emails?</a></p>



<p>Aiding to the same, here are the <strong>mistakes that you must avoid</strong>.</p>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li><strong>Using a Misleading Subject Line: </strong>The CAN-SPAM act of the US says that it is actually against the law to mislead someone with your subject line to make them see your message.<br>In a Litmus and Fluent survey, nearly <a aria-label=" (opens in a new tab)" href="https://litmus.com/blog/misleading-subject-lines"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ener nofollow">50% of participants</a> said that they have felt cheated, tricked or deceived into opening outreach or a promotional email by its subject line at least once.<br> <br> Some examples of such misleading subject lines:<br> <br> &#8211; <strong><em>Did I leave my jacket at your place?</em></strong> Subject lines like these may trick you into assuming that the sender knows you.<br> <br> &#8211; <strong><em>Thanks for your order!</em></strong> Using transactional subject lines when no transactions are actually involved will most probably land you in the spam-box.<br> <br> &#8211; <strong><em>RE: CURRENTLY IN OFFICE: </em></strong>Do you get what the sender is trying to do? Well, it’s a lot about creating an urgency, making you feel like it’s a mail from your workplace.<br> <br> &#8211; <strong><em>Urgent – Update your information: </em></strong>And then you click-through to see someone selling you hair-oil (totally not urgent).<br>Hope you get the point. While it’s crucial to use intriguing subject lines, you should make sure you are not spamming. </li>



<li><strong>Incorrect Information:</strong> Another reason why your emails may land in the spam-box is that you included false facts or baseless information in your email.<br>This one also simply goes against the CAN-SPAM act. So, make sure you don’t include anything that is way too promising or can’t be backed or cited.</li>



<li><strong>Fake ‘From’ Information:</strong> Well, as simple as it comes, it’s totally illegal to fake your identity. And this one can even go beyond just the CAN-SPAM rules.<br>So, never ever pretend to be someone you are not.</li>



<li><strong>Spam Trigger Words:</strong> While not every spam filter in the world is too critical, some of them run with strict functions that are programmed to trigger filter against various words.<br>Some of the most commonly used words that may trigger the spam filter are:<br>  &#8211; amazing<br> &#8211; cancel at any time<br> &#8211; check or money order<br> &#8211; click here<br> &#8211; congratulations<br> &#8211; dear friend<br> &#8211; for only ($)<br> &#8211; free or toll-free<br> &#8211; great offer<br> &#8211; guarantee<br> &#8211; increase sales<br> &#8211; order not<br> &#8211; promise you<br> &#8211; risk-free<br> &#8211; special promotion<br> &#8211; this is not spam<br> &#8211; winner<br> <br>So, you know what not to do? Avoid using these words/phrases as much as you can.</li>
</ul>
